Understanding the Basics: What to Look for in a Treadmill

Before diving into particular treadmill designs, it’s necessary to comprehend the crucial aspects to consider when selecting a treadmill for home usage. Here’s a fast list:

Key Features to Consider:

  1. Space: Size is a crucial element. Measure the area where you plan to position the Treadmill For Home Use to ensure it fits easily.
  2. Weight Capacity: Check the treadmill’s weight limit to accommodate all prospective users.
  3. Motor Power: A more effective motor (measured in horsepower) usually supplies a smoother experience, especially for slope usage.
  4. Running Surface: Consider the treadmill’s belt size and cushioning; longer and larger belts are perfect for running convenience.
  5. Incline and Speed Settings: Look for designs that provide numerous incline settings and adjustable speed levels for varied exercises.
  6. Innovation & & Features: Many treadmills included innovative features such as Bluetooth connection, built-in speakers, and exercise programs.
  7. Warranty: An extensive warranty can supply assurance regarding the quality and toughness of the treadmill.

Leading Treadmills for Home Use in the UK

1. NordicTrack T 6.5 Si Treadmill

The NordicTrack T 6.5 Si is a preferred among fitness enthusiasts. It offers:

  • Motor: 2.6 HP motor for seamless operation.
  • Running Surface: 20″ x 55″ tread belt, supplying ample space for various workout routines.
  • Slope: 0-10% quick incline settings for more intense sessions.
  • Programs: Offers a wide array of integrated workouts through iFit, which can improve motivation and variety.
  • Innovation: 10-inch touchscreen display and Bluetooth audio capabilities enhance user experience.

2. ProForm 505 CST Treadmill

Designed for both beginners and knowledgeable users, the ProForm 505 CST integrates affordability with efficiency:

  • Motor: 2.5 HP motor balances power and performance.
  • Running Surface: 20″ x 55″ deck, ideal for all running styles.
  • Slope: 0-10% slope to challenge users with time.
  • Unique Features: 18 built-in exercise programs and compatibility with iFit for a more appealing experience.

3. Reebok Jet 100 Treadmill

The Reebok Jet 100 is an exceptional option for those concentrated on affordable yet effective home exercises:

  • Motor: 2 HP motor, suitable for moderate running and walking.
  • Running Surface: 16″ x 50″ running area, appropriate for walking and running.
  • Incline: Manual incline adjustment with three settings to include range.
  • Extras: Offers a built-in stereo and compatibility with physical fitness apps for a detailed exercise experience.

4. JLL S300 Digital Folding Treadmill

An outstanding option for those with restricted area, the JLL S300 is compact and effective:

  • Motor: 2.5 HP motor for consistent performance.
  • Running Surface: 40″ x 16″ running location; compact and ideal for walking/running.
  • Incline: Multiple incline settings to vary exercises.
  • Space-saving Design: Folds for simple storage, making it best for home use.

Comparison Table

Model Motor (HP) Running Surface (inches) Incline Price Range
NordicTrack T 6.5 Si 2.6 20 x 55 0-10% ₤ 700 – ₤ 800
ProForm 505 CST 2.5 20 x 55 0-10% ₤ 600 – ₤ 700
Reebok Jet 100 2.0 16 x 50 Manual ₤ 400 – ₤ 500
JLL S300 2.5 40 x 16 Manual ₤ 300 – ₤ 400

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How much area do I need for a treadmill?

  • Ideally, you ought to have a clearance of at least 2-3 feet around the treadmill for security and comfort.

2. Can I use a treadmill every day?

  • Yes, many individuals utilize treadmills daily; nevertheless, it’s vital to listen to your body and include day of rest to avoid overtraining.

3. Are folding treadmills reliable?

  • Yes, folding treadmills can be as reliable as non-folding ones and provide the included benefit of conserving space.

4. What is the best way to maintain a treadmill?

  • Routinely tidy the belt, oil it as needed, and inspect for loose parts to make sure longevity.

5. Do I need an adjustable incline?

  • An adjustable incline is advantageous for added exercise range and increased calorie burn.
